Output 62e1aea596ed7a14c80275ff8e0a9b4abec78a4743da59cd99c707951631850d:0

value
26801
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b8d93d46e88d80d054a484ef638253f917388a2 OP_EQUAL
address
3CxJe7XLioxnpNEo3qETRtRxZrLKhgCMso
transaction
62e1aea596ed7a14c80275ff8e0a9b4abec78a4743da59cd99c707951631850d
confirmations
239133
spent
true